Enjoy an up-close-and-personal view of the Insecta Class with these Preserved Grasshoppers from Frey Scientific. As insects are the both the largest and most diverse group of animals on earth, these common grasshopper specimens will allow your students to identify the 3 key body regions (head, thorax, and abdomen), 3 pairs of legs (attached to the thorax), the set of antennas on head, mouthparts, and 2 pairs of wings. Each of these grasshopper specimens measure 3 inches or larger. Sold as pail of 50.
- Preserved grasshoppers are excellent, intriguing specimens for dissection and learning basic insect anatomy
- Three-inch or larger size of each specimen provides ideal student sample size for identifying key internal and external parts and structures
- Only dissection scissors are needed to get started with grasshopper specimen dissection
- Preserved grasshoppers will have tissues and organs that are extremely lifelike while retaining their color and texture
- Pail of 50 preserved grasshopper specimens offer economical, hands-on aid for biology class and comparative anatomy dissections
